Size

Before you purchase, think about the size of your living space and whether you want to include the sofa along with other furniture. You can visit a walk-in showroom to view the sofa in person and get an idea of its fabric or color before making a purchase. You should also measure all the doors in your house to ensure that the delivery service is able to pass through the doorway. Certain sofas have legs that can be removed or unlocked to increase the size of the doorway. Cost is another factor to consider along with the features of the sofa. Sofas with reclining or sleeper features are usually more expensive than regular couches modular. If a sofa is equipped with recline mechanisms, be sure you test them thoroughly.

A good couch will have a strong inner frame constructed of solid wood not plastic or particle board. Some cheaper couches use a wooden framework that warps and becomes sagging over time. Higher-quality couches will have frames made of wood that are kiln dried to give a better stability and durability.

Selecting the right fabric for your sofa will affect its durability as well as how it appears in your living space. If your sofa is going to be used often it is recommended to choose the fabric that is tough and stain-resistant. Microfibers are a great choice for heavy usage areas and textured fabrics exhibit less wear and wear than smooth fabrics. Leather is a great option when you are planning to keep your sofa for a long time. It is easy to maintain and durable.

Frame material:

There are a number of different materials that sofas can be made of. Some couches are made of solid wood while others have plywood frames. In either case frames should be dried in order to prevent the frame from bending over time.

Cushion filling:

The type of filling for sofas can impact the appearance and feel. It can be made from feathers, foam or polyester fiber. For instance, some couches use a layer of foam in the cushions to provide support and structure, whereas others may have feathers added for a more luxurious look and feel.

Seating suspension:

The method of seat suspension can also influence the overall quality of the sofa. Some sofas are equipped with sinuous spring units, whereas others use coil spring units or Elastabelt webbing. These suspensions are renowned for being durable and comfortable.

Upholstery:

The upholstery for a sofa can be made from various materials such as leather. The choice of fabric is typically an individual choice, however it is essential to select an extremely durable, long-lasting fabric that can withstand wear and tear. Certain couches are easy to clean and suitable for families with pets or children.

Sit on the sofa lean back and test its comfort. Press down on the cushion to see if it swiftly returns to its original shape. If the cushion sags over time, it may cause lower back pain.

Pay attention to the frame too. The corners should be cushioned and not exposed metal. You should also feel the springs in the upholstery, which could be a sign of quality. Also, make sure the sofa is not made of flammable materials and that it's upholstered with a fire-resistant material.
